 Established in 1968, Gilead has over 50 years of experience providing the highest quality services that support each person’s recovery from mental health or substance use challenges in their lives. Gilead empowers personal growth, independence and recovery through improved mental health, physical well-being, and community integration. Gilead’s supportive and collaborative services are marked by excellence, compassion, innovation, and integrity.

Gilead Community Services is seeking an attentive and recovery-oriented Social Rehabilitation Counselor to join our multi-disciplinary program staff.

About the position:

The Social Rehabilitation Counselor for Gilead’s Chester area adult social rehabilitation program works Monday – Friday 8:30AM-4:30PM (40 hours per week) providing case management, advocacy, and outreach in a program serving adults with major mental illness. The individual in this role carries out all phases of social support service including intake, engagement, assessment, treatment planning, case management, referral, and discharge. This role also requires the timely completion of required documentation including assessments and other treatment planning.

Responsibilities:

  • Providing clinical knowledge regarding severe and prolonged mental health and substance abuse disorders through training and education
  • Providing recovery-oriented case-management and social support services with an emphasis on dignity and respect through intervention and support, inclusion of family and community, and supportive counseling
  • Providing socialization activities within the Social Center, following the International Community Clubhouse model of care
  • Communicating with other care providers to coordinate care
  • Monitoring positive outcome measures and ensuring compliance through accurate and timely data reporting
  • Completing assessments, treatment planning documents, and other documentation electronically and on paper in a timely manner
  • Acting with compassion, integrity, and ethics
